    German Engineering at its finest

    This is the new EV12 vrom Brabus.

    It has a:

    6.3ltr V12 Twin-Turbo with 640 BHP at 5100 RPM
    1026 NM Torque at 1750 RPM
    (0-60mph) 0-100km/h 4.5 sec
    (0-180mph) 0-300km/h 30 sec.
    Topspeed:350 km/h (220mph)

    Brabus are sorta Mercedes tuning department. I say sorta because I don't think they're owned by Merc, but only work on them.
